1. What causes sewer lines to Snow Damage, freeze and create problems?

Water trapped in your sewer line can freeze when temperatures drop below 0. The water expands and blocks your pipe, preventing the rest of the water from passing through. This causes a malfunction in your sewer line. Also, pooling water makes it unhygienic and unsanitary.

2. How can I keep my sewer line from freezing?

So that you don’t deal with frozen lines this winter, here are some preventative measures to avoid it:

Insulate pipes

When sewer pipes are not well insulated, the risk of water inside freezing increases. Wrap pipe insulation around plumbing lines and secure it with electrical tape.

Inspect your water heater

Inspect your water heater to make sure it maintains proper water temperature. In colder months, turn your water heater up a couple of degrees to keep it from freezing.
